Network interface board configuration 
settings information
Use the show command to display
the network interface board configu-
ration settings.
msh> show [-p]
Note
❒ Add “-p” to the show command to
have the information displayed
one screen at a time.
Reference
For more information about the
meaning of the data returned us-
ing this command, see p.95 “Con-
figuring the Network Interface
Board”.
System log information
Use the syslog command to display
information stored in the system log.
msh> syslog
Reference
For more information about the
displayed information, see p.99
“System Log Information”.
SNMP
Use the snmp command to display
and edit SNMP configuration settings
such as the community name.
Note
❒ The 1394 interface board supports
TCP/IP only.
❒ You can configure from ten SNMP
access settings numbered 1-10.
❒ Default access settings 1 and 2 are
as follows.
❖ Display
Shows the SNMP information and
available protocols.
msh> snmp ?
msh> snmp [-p] [registered_
number
]
Note
❒ If  the  -p  option  is  added,  you
can view the settings one by
one.
❒ Omitting the number displays
all access settings.
